.c <br /> ANNUAL TOWN MEETING - MARCH 25, 1985 <br /> The meeting was called to order in Cary Memorial Hall at 8 P.M. by Moderator, <br /> Lincoln P. Cole, Jr. <br /> There were 156 Town Meeting Members present. <br /> Invocation was offered by Reverend Gay M. Godfrey, Associate Minister at the <br /> Hancock United Church of Christ. 8:01 P.M. <br /> The Moderator asked for a moment of silence in memory of Manfred P. Friedman, <br /> Town Meeting Member from Precinct 7, who died on January 3, 1985. 8:02 P.M. <br /> Town Clerk, Mary R. McDonough, read the Warrant for the meeting until further <br /> reading was waived by the meeting. 8:03 P.M. <br /> The Town Clerk read the Constable's Return of the Warrant. 8:05 P.M. <br /> Article 2. REPORTS OF TOWN BOARDS, <br /> OFFICERS, COMMITTEES <br /> lone D. Garing moved that the report of the Committee on Cary Lectures <br /> be accepted and placed on file. <br /> Adopted unanimously. 8:06 P.M. <br /> The Moderator stated that Article 2 would be open to receive reports <br /> throughout the entire meeting. 8:06 P.M. <br /> Article 3. APPOINTMENT TO CARY LECTURE SERIES <br /> Presented by Paul W. Marshall. <br /> MOTION: That a committee of three be appointed by the Moderator to <br /> have the charge of the lectures under the wills of Eliza Cary Farnham <br /> and Suzanna E. Cary for the current year. <br /> Adopted unanimously. 8:07 P.M. <br /> Article 4. CHARLES FERGUSON FUND <br /> Presented by Paul W. Marshall. <br /> MOTION: That the Town accept with gratitude the gift of the late <br /> Alice R. Ferguson in the amount of $5,000.00 in memory of Charles <br /> E. Ferguson. <br /> 8:07 P.M. <br /> Mr. Marshall informed the meeting that Mr.. Ferguson had been a long <br /> term public servant for the Town of Lexington having served as <br /> Selectman, Moderator, State Representative and State Senator. <br /> Motion, as presented by Mr. Marshall, declared adopted unanimously. <br /> 8:07 P.M. <br /> Article 2. REPORTS OF TOWN BOARDS, <br /> OFFICERS, COMMITTEES <br /> Paul W. Marshall, Chairman of the Board of Selectmen, reported that <br /> Articles 3 through 9 would be brought up tonight. He understood <br /> that there would be a motion to take up Article 17 out of order and <br /> to discuss Articles 7 and 17 together but to vote on each of them <br /> separately. He also said that the plan was to bring up the zoning <br /> articles on Wednesday, March 27th, with the exception of Article 11 <br /> which would be brought up on Monday, April 1. <br /> 8:09 P.M. <br />
